Comparing 'J' poles and 1/4 wave antennas is apples and oranges. The 1/4 wave is... a 1/4 wave long and has the characteristics of any/all 1/4 wave antennas. A 'J' pole is a 1/2 wave antenna with difference characteristics, one of which is a generally "bigger" radiation pattern.
Since comparisons are made using radiation patterns I would think that the 1/4 wave would come out the looser... all other things being at least equal. If you have to hide the thing, the 1/4 wave might be easier to use. Wrap plastic 'ivy' around it and plant it in a pot...
